MIIT: mobile traffic data tariffs should be decreased by 30% in 2015

Updated:2015/7/8 10:38

On July 6th, MIIT put forward specific goals on “reduce the network tariffs” in the special news conference: by the end of 2015, the mobile phone traffic data average tariff, fixed broadband average tariff should be reduced by 30%.

In addition, in June of this year, the three major operators put forward their own "improve the speed and cut down the tariff" programs. The mobile phone traffic data tariff decreasing goal that MIIT proposed was a little lower than China Mobile’s 35% decreasing goal, the broadband tariff reduction was slightly lower than 35% that China Telecom has proposed.

For the 30% reduction targets, some experts believed that it was not difficult to achieve this goal by the end of the year. "Take the mobile traffic data for example, there were very little 4G subscribers in last year, but it has increased to 200 million in May of this year. The rapid expansion of user scale reduced the per unit cost of network construction."

Among the three major operators, China Unicom bears obvious pressure in this tariff reducing process. Upgrading the mobile network from 3G to 4G is the basis for reducing the traffic data tariffs, since the 3G network traffic cost is significantly higher than that of 4G network. However, 4G business development of China Unicom is worse than the expectations, which also faces pressure from the competitors’ increased investment in 4G.
